- Check the Source: Is it a well-known news outlet with a good reputation? Look for established organizations with a history of accurate reporting.
- Look for Multiple Sources: Does the story appear on other news sites? If multiple sources are reporting the same information, it's more likely to be accurate.
- Watch Out for Bias: Does the source have a particular political agenda? Be aware of potential bias and try to get your news from a variety of sources.
- Read Carefully: Are there typos or grammatical errors? A professional news organization should have editors who catch these mistakes.
- Check the Author: Who wrote the article? Are they a credible journalist with expertise in the subject?

Local TV Channels
Local TV channels are a classic and reliable source for live news. Stations like WPLG Local 10, WSVN 7News, and WTVJ NBC 6 offer live broadcasts throughout the day. These channels usually have morning, noon, evening, and late-night news programs, so you can catch up on the latest headlines no matter your schedule. Many of these stations also stream their broadcasts online, so you can watch on your computer or mobile device. This is especially handy if you're on the go or don't have access to a TV. Local TV news often includes interviews with local leaders, reports on community events, and in-depth coverage of important issues. Plus, they usually have weather forecasts and traffic updates, which are essential for planning your day in Fort Lauderdale. To make the most of local TV news, check out the station's website or social media pages for a schedule of live broadcasts. You can also set up alerts to be notified when breaking news occurs. This way, you'll always be in the loop, no matter what's happening in the city.

Radio Stations
Don't forget about local radio stations! They're not just for music; many also broadcast live news updates, especially during morning and afternoon drive times. Tune into stations like WLRN 91.3 FM for NPR news or check out local talk radio for community discussions. Radio is great because you can listen while you're driving, working, or doing chores. Plus, many stations stream online, so you can listen from anywhere. Local radio often features interviews with community leaders and experts, providing in-depth analysis of local issues. You can also call in to talk shows and share your opinions on the air. Radio is an excellent way to stay connected to Fort Lauderdale while you're on the go. Many stations also have podcasts of their news programs, so you can listen to them at your convenience. This is perfect for catching up on the news when you have some downtime. Local radio is a classic and reliable source of information that's still relevant today.
